How to Uninstall and Reinstall emWave Pro on Windows

If you are upgrading your hardware or troubleshooting software performance, follow these steps for a complete uninstallation and a successful reinstall of the emWave Pro software.

Phase 1: Uninstall the Current Software

  1. Close emWave Pro: Ensure the application and any associated hardware (USB sensor) are disconnected.
  2. Open Settings: Click the Start menu and select the Settings (gear icon).
  3. Locate the App: Navigate to Apps > Installed Apps (on Windows 11) or Apps & Features (on Windows 10).
  4. Remove emWave: Scroll through the list to find emWave. Click the three dots (or the app name) and select Uninstall. Follow the Windows prompts to complete the process.

Phase 2: Perform a “Clean” Uninstall (Optional but Recommended)

To ensure no corrupted files remain, perform these extra steps:

  • Open File Explorer and go to C:\Program Files (x86).
  • If you see a folder named HeartMath, right-click and Delete it.
  • Important: Your personal session data is stored in Documents/emWave. This folder is generally not deleted during uninstallation, keeping your history safe.

Phase 3: Download and Reinstall

  1. Download the Latest Version: Navigate to the official HeartMath Downloads Page.
  2. Select Your Product: Choose the installer for emWave Pro / Plus for Windows.
  3. Run the Installer: Once the download is complete, double-click the file to begin the installation.
  4. Enter Registration: If prompted, enter your Registration Number (found on your original Quick Start Guide or within your purchase email).

Troubleshooting Tips

  • Restart Your PC: It is highly recommended to restart your computer after uninstalling and before reinstalling to flush temporary memory.
  • Check for Updates: Once reinstalled, go to Help > Check for Updates within the software to ensure you have the absolute latest patches.
